Cash Functions
The various roles and activities associated with cash management in a business, including collection, disbursement, and investment.
Treasurer
An officer of a company or organization responsible for managing the institution's treasury, including financial planning, risk management, and investment.
Chief Operations Officer
A senior executive tasked with overseeing the day-to-day administrative and operational functions of a company.
Working Capital Management
The management of a company's short-term assets and liabilities to ensure its ongoing operational efficiency and financial stability.
